Felhasznalasi lehetősegeit irodalmi osszefoglaloval es kutatocsoportunk korabbi eredmenyeiből szarmazo peldakkal szemleltetjuk.This study summarizes the Hungarian adaptation of the Phenomenology of Consciousness Inventory (PCI, Pekala, 1982, 1991) and the results with its application. The 53-item self-report questionnaire measures the intensity and pattern of alterations of consciousness with fourteen main and twelve subdimensions. In line with the interactional approach to hypnosis the PCI can be used not just with subjects but with hypnotists as well. The PCI can be applied not just in hypnosis but in any other situation where alterations in consciousness can be expected. Thus the PCI makes it possible to compare the subjective experiences of altered states of consciousness, either occuring spontaneously or induced by different methods.The reliability of the PCI is adequate, and it’s construct and discriminative validity is supported by numerous international and Hungarian studies. The PCI is therefore a good method for the quantification of subjective experiences occuring during various types of altered states of consciousness in general, and it is an especially useful tool in hypnosis research. Various possible applications of the PCI are illustrated by a literature review and examples from previous studies of our research team." @default.
